Weather at Chamera Lake
Visitors experience comfortable weather at Chamera Lake throughout every month, which draws nature enthusiasts for recreation. From March to June, the summer climate at Chamera Lake stays between 20°C and 35°C, permitting various outdoor activities. During monsoon season (July to September), the lake becomes more enchanting due to heavy rainfall, yet boating remains restricted. Temperatures during the winter months of October to February reach their minimum at 2°C, which produces dramatic results of chilly nights alongside misty mornings. This season promotes pleasant sightseeing together with recreational water activities.

How to Reach Chamera Lake?
Travelers find it simple to reach Chamera Lake Dalhousie through convenient transport connections. Multiple accessible pathways lead to this destination effectively.
- By Air: Travellers can find Gaggal Airport near Dharamshala as the closest airport to Chamera Lake at a distance of 130 kilometers. The airport provides regular service to major Indian metropolitan areas. Travelers who arrive at the destination can use taxis or buses to access Chamera Lake.
- By Road: Private vehicles, along with taxis and local buses, serve as effective transport options to access Chamera Lake because it maintains good road connections. The Chamera Lake distance from Dalhousie is under 25 km, and regular buses provide mountain scenery during their journey.
- By Train: The nearest railway stop is Pathankot Railway Station, which is 100 kilometers away from Chamera Lake. One can choose between taxis and buses that provide easy access from Pathankot Railway Station to any desired location.

5. Sach Pass
Sach Pass provides adventure enthusiasts with their divine destination by offering them high-altitude road journeys into dramatic mountainous territory. The elevation of Sach Pass lies around 4,420 meters, which creates a challenging path between Chamba Valley and isolated Pangi Valley. Tourists visit the open pass route between June and October to take advantage of its beautiful scenery while trekking and biking. Nature enthusiasts and thrill-seekers will cherish Sach Pass because it combines snow-covered mountains and flowing watercourses alongside expansive sights of the surroundings.
- Distance: 100 km
- Timings: June - October
6. Chamba Town
The Ravi River borders the historical town of Chamba, which showcases ancient shrines, vivid traditional customs and its extensive historical heritage. Within the town stands three famous landmarks that comprise the Lakshmi Narayan Temple and Rang Mahal together with Bhuri Singh Museum, which exhibits rare paintings, sculptures and artifacts. Chamba also hosts the annual Minjar Festival, drawing visitors from across the country. Cultural lovers from across the nation choose this destination because of its surrounding calm scenery and architectural beauty.
- Distance: 35 km
- Timings: Open 24 hours

Frequently Asked Questions:
1. What is the best time to visit Chamera Lake?
The best time to visit is March to June and September to November, when the weather is pleasant and ideal for sightseeing and boating.
2. Are there any activities to do at Chamera Lake?
Yes, visitors can enjoy boating, fishing, photography, and nature walks, along with breathtaking views of the surrounding hills.
3. How far is Chamera Lake from Dalhousie?
Chamera Lake is around 25 km from Dalhousie, making it an easy and scenic drive through the mountains.
4. Is there an entry fee for visiting Chamera Lake?
No, there is no entry fee to visit Chamera Lake, but charges apply for boating and other activities.
5. Are there accommodations near Chamera Lake?
Yes, several hotels, resorts, and guesthouses are available in Chamera Lake and nearby areas for a comfortable stay.
